Fleet Management: Wireless Matrix Further Accelerates Expanding Mobile Resource Management Application Capabilities With Acquisition Of Sapias
Wireless Matrix Corporation, one of the leading provider of Mobile Resource Management (MRM) solutions, recently announced that it has acquired select assets and liabilities of San Francisco-based on-demand MRM provider Sapias, Inc., for a total of $2,720,000 in cash ($2,020,000) and stock ($700,000) consideration. The deal builds on the company's 2006 acquisition of MobileAria, further expanding the comprehensive functions and features of its web-based FleetOutlook solution to include real-time planning and execution capabilities.
The deal brings over 3,500 new subscribers from a number of Tier-1 accounts, strengthening Wireless Matrix's position in several significant vertical markets, including the cable, utility and propane industries. It increases Wireless Matrix's total subscriber base to over 50,000 nationwide and adds over two million in projected annual service revenue to the Company's operations. Wireless Matrix will also retain the Sapias application development and support teams to continue to enhance the application suite.

Wireless Matrix's Mobile Resource Management solutions help businesses optimize field service workforce productivity while enhancing customer service. Delivered on a hosted,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) basis, FleetOutlook is a comprehensive 360 degrees MRM solution, backed by 24x7 support, which enables the full value chain of dynamic schedule planning and execution. From vehicle mapping, tracking and operational reporting to XML data export and optional telematics monitoring, it offers features that maximize productivity and reduce cost.
